Key specs that matter for real use

Magnification and objective lens

This scope uses a 20-60x zoom with an 85mm objective lens (BAK4 prism optics and FMC coating). In practice, the larger objective and coatings are meant to help with brightness and contrast, which can be useful for low-light conditions like early morning or dusk.

Field of view at different distances

The listed wide field of view changes with magnification (101 ft at lower power to 48 ft at higher power, stated at 1000 yards). That wider low-power view can help when you are searching for birds or wildlife, while higher magnification is for detailed inspection once you have a target.

Tripod stability and aiming

The included adjustable full-size tripod is designed to get the scope positioned at different heights, with a stated adjustment range from 13.3 in to 63 in and a bubble level for more accurate setup. Several reviews note that having a tripod is helpful because of the scope’s weight, and mount rotation is described positively, though some buyers want easier access to locking controls.

Weather handling

The scope is rated waterproof and fogproof (IPX5 listed, fogproof stated as yes) and is nitrogen filled. That combination is intended to make it more dependable in typical outdoor conditions like light rain or humid days.

Performance expectations (and realistic limits)

Across reviews, the main strength is optical clarity, especially when targets are not at the extreme limits of what the magnification range can reasonably resolve. For close to mid-range viewing, multiple owners describe sharp, clear images and easy identification of distant details. As distances increase and magnification is pushed, a pattern of “fuzziness” on edges or less crisp detail appears in some reports. If your typical use is long-range identification, you may need to manage expectations and rely more on lower-to-mid zoom settings for the best image stability and detail.
